Nigeria: Saraki Hands Ministerial List; Buhari Convenes Cabinet

Nigeria's Senate President Bukola Saraki paid a visit to President Mohammad Buhari to deliver the final list of 36 ministerial nominees the upper house confirmed, the latest in a vote Tuesday morning. Welcoming the Senate action, Buhari said the Presidency would now proceed to assign portfolios to each.He said he was required by the Constitution to name one minister from each of the 36 states, "but the constitution did not say I must have 36 ministries." Some of the 36 of expected to be named minister of state or deputy to a full minister.
